Sascha Report post Posted May 26, 2008 Just to cut it short here: - The AM-/VE-Plugins bundled with Samplitude/Sequoia as well as VariVerb Pro and Robota Pro are technically VST plugins, but are also technically blocked for other VST-capable host software. So they will be rejected by any of those. - AM-/VE-Suite & VariVerb Pro can be purchased seperately as 'unbundled' VST versions that can run in any VST host software. Registered Samplitude/Sequoia users get a 50% discount upon purchase of either VST package. - The VSTs can be purchased as download versions (directly from our site) or as boxed version.
